Investigation of Hybrid Ionic Liquid Surfactants for Chemical Enhanced Oil Recovery
Enhanced oil recovery (EOR) is being vastly applied and studied in the oil industry and various technologies have emerged over the last decades in order to optimize oil recovery after primary and secondary recovery methods have been applied.
